DrHenley 07-31-2014 10:20 PM

I really, I mean REALLY like that mag release cut. Almost like having an extended mag release. I had a problem in IDPA matches pushing the mag release without shifting my grip or twisting the gun (I got procedural for my muzzle going up while trying to push the mag release)

On the full sized 1911s I installed an extended mag release, but I won't have to on the compact.

Caleb 07-31-2014 10:31 PM

Yes I agree, the "scoop" cut is great. I have smaller hands so I'm always shifting my grip to release the mag. I bought the slim grips with the scoop and now it's perfect in my hands.

Can't you just sand down the back to make the mag well ears fit?

DrHenley 07-31-2014 10:56 PM

Wood maybe, but sanding G10 is nasty business. The dust is really bad for your lungs.
